			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img src="http://cdg.theoffside.com/files/2008/11/5127_grande.jpg" alt="" width="360" height="269" class="alignleft size-full wp-image-39" />This time it seems to be official. It&#8217;s not a training deal anymore. Nestor de la Torre announced that <a href="http://www.mexico.worldcupblog.org">Nery Castillo</a> would be part of the squad after his participation in tomorrow&#8217;s Mexico game against Ecuador in Phoenix. He would then be available for La Liga and the <a href="http://www.sudamericana.theoffside.com">Sudamericana</a>. As of now it seems like Shakhtar(the original owner of the player) and <a href="http://www.mancity.theoffside.com">Manchester City</a>(where Nery is on loan) have agreed to the deal as well and the only thing needed to register the player for the tournaments is his registration from the Premier League. </p>
<p>This deal comes as a surprise as only a few weeks ago, the player claimed to have no interest in playing  in the America&#8217;s. His mind was changed according to de la Torre based on his previous days&#8217; experience of training with the team, the installations, and his observation of the game against <a href="http://www.riverplate.theoffside.com">River Plate</a>. If the deal goes through he may play at the Jalisco Stadium Saturday evening against Los Indio de Ciudad Juarez. </p>
<p>Now the game against Puebla that seemed to guarantee our entry into the Liguilla seems to be behind everyone. Several players were rested Sunday for the anticipated game against Inter on Wednesday night. Efrain Flores is taking the blame for the teams bad performance but he is not entirely to blame. Everyone, including the young ones were so sure of themselves they once again underestimated the opponent. </p>

<p>The captain, Pato Araujo received a red for a terrible tackle which was more of a result of anger more than actually trying to get to the ball. Before that, both goals had already been scored and it showed that our defense was full of inexperienced players. In the very end(91st min) it was Sergio Santana who gave us the consolation goal. </p>
